Ticket: Vault lockout — Tilecrag cache layer

The Bramblehook vault guarding the tile-rendering cache credentials locked after three failed unlock attempts during the Quellport deploy. Cache invalidation jobs are stalled; stale tiles are being served in the Marrowfield region. Standard unseal is unavailable until the morning rotation. Support may restore service immediately using the recovery passphrase below.

recovery phrase for kajop-yagef: istael-ulaius

**Internal Memo — Board Distribution**

The eight-week pilot with Drayton Goods is confirmed for twelve stores in the Ferrow Valley region. Our Shelfline units will be installed over two weekends with minimal disruption. Drayton covers staffing; we cover hardware and reporting. Early metrics arrive in week three. The following applies to expansion terms.

management briefing: Project Ulavan slips by two quarters because of the staffing delay.

Onboarding note: the Fernhollow calendar sync will double-book you against the Drexline standup until your profile merge completes. Ignore the phantom invites; they clear after the nightly reconcile. Do not decline them manually or the sync loop restarts. To force a merge early, unlock the Marwick sync vault, which opens with the recovery passphrase noted directly below.

unlock words, yawig-kagef: gordor-holvan-ulaael-pramir-ulaiel-tamdor

Handover Note — from P. Linwood to A. Cearra, Director of Channel, Bryton Instruments

For the finance team: the reseller programme now covers fourteen partners across three tiers, with rebates accrued quarterly against verified sell-through rather than sell-in. Two partners remain on probationary terms pending audit. Accrual models and margin assumptions are in the shared workbook; please reconcile before month-end. The forward plan for the programme is summarised in the note below.

confidential, kagep-kahof: Druokax Systems plans to lower the Ulaath list price by 53 percent in March.